How Much Do Shipping Container Homes Cost to Build?
Shipping container homes are becoming increasingly popular among modern home-seekers who want to make use of sustainable, cost-effective and eco-friendly housing solutions. Shipping containers, typically used to transport goods across the globe, are being repurposed and converted into residential spaces that offer everything from basic shelter to luxurious living. But how much do shipping container homes cost to build?
The answer depends on a number of factors, including the size of the container, the materials used for construction, and the complexity of the design. Generally speaking, the cost of constructing a shipping container home can range from as little as $20,000 to upwards of $150,000. It’s important to note that these prices do not include the cost of the shipping container itself; the cost of the container will need to be factored into the overall cost of the project.
For those who are working with a limited budget, a basic studio-style container home may be the most cost-effective option. These homes are typically constructed using one or two shipping containers and can be designed to accommodate a small kitchen and bathroom. Prices typically start around $20,000, but can reach upwards of $50,000 depending on the complexity of the design.
